_11 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_12 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_13 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_14 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_21 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_22 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_23 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_24 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_31 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_32 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_33 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_34 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_41 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_42 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_43 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_44 (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
_m (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
adjoint() const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
CLIPSPACE2DTOIMAGESPACE | ParaEngine::Matrix4 | static |
determinant() const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
extract3x3Matrix(Matrix3 &m3x3) const | ParaEngine::Matrix4 | inline |
extractQuaternion() const | ParaEngine::Matrix4 | inline |
ExtractScaling(float Tolerance=SMALL_NUMBER) | ParaEngine::Matrix4 | |
GetConstPointer() const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
GetMatrixWithoutScale(float Tolerance=SMALL_NUMBER) const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
GetPointer() (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
GetScaleByAxis(int axis, float Tolerance=SMALL_NUMBER) const | ParaEngine::Matrix4 | |
GetScaleVector(float Tolerance=SMALL_NUMBER) const | ParaEngine::Matrix4 | |
getTrans() const | ParaEngine::Matrix4 | inline |
hasNegativeScale() const | ParaEngine::Matrix4 | inline |
hasScale() const | ParaEngine::Matrix4 | |
IDENTITY (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| static |
identity() | ParaEngine::Matrix4 | inline |
inverse() const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
invert() (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
InvertPRMatrix() const | ParaEngine::Matrix4 | |
isAffine(void) const | ParaEngine::Matrix4 | inline |
isAffineColumnMajor(void) const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
m (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
makeInverseTransform(const Vector3 &position, const Vector3 &scale, const Quaternion &orientation) | ParaEngine::Matrix4 | |
makeRot(const Quaternion &orientation, const Vector3 &origin) | ParaEngine::Matrix4 | |
makeScale(float s_x, float s_y, float s_z) | ParaEngine::Matrix4 | inline |
makeScale(const Vector3 &v)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
makeTrans(const Vector3 &v) | ParaEngine::Matrix4 | inline |
makeTrans(float tx, float ty, float tz)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
makeTransform(const Vector3 &position, const Vector3 &scale, const Quaternion &orientation) | ParaEngine::Matrix4 | |
Matrix4() | ParaEngine::Matrix4 | inline |
Matrix4(float m00, float m01, float m02, float m03, float m10, float m11, float m12, float m13, float m20, float m21, float m22, float m23, float m30, float m31, float m32, float m33)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
Matrix4(const Matrix3 &m3x3) | ParaEngine::Matrix4 | inline |
Matrix4(const DeviceMatrix &mat)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
Matrix4(const QMatrix &mat2DAffine) | ParaEngine::Matrix4 | |
Matrix4(const Quaternion &rot) | ParaEngine::Matrix4 | inline |
Multiply4x3(const Matrix4 &m2) const | ParaEngine::Matrix4 | |
offsetTrans(const Vector3 &v)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ator!=(const Matrix4 &m2) const | ParaEngine::Matrix4 | inline |
operator*(const Matrix4 &m2) const | ParaEngine::Matrix4 | inline |
operator*(const Vector3 &v) const | ParaEngine::Matrix4 | inline |
operator*(const Vector4 &v) const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ator*(const Plane &p) const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ator*(float scalar) const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ator*=(const Matrix4 &m2)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ator+(const Matrix4 &m2) const | ParaEngine::Matrix4 | inline |
operator+=(const Matrix4 &m2)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ator-(const Matrix4 &m2) const | ParaEngine::Matrix4 | inline |
operator-=(const Matrix4 &m2)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ator<<(std::ostream &o, const Matrix4 &m) | ParaEngine::Matrix4 | friend |
operator=(const Matrix3 &mat3) | ParaEngine::Matrix4 | inline |
operator==(const Matrix4 &m2) const | ParaEngine::Matrix4 | inline |
operator[](size_t iRow)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
operator[](size_t iRow) const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
RemoveScaling(float Tolerance=SMALL_NUMBER) (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
RemoveTranslation() const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| |
setScale(const Vector3 &v) | ParaEngine::Matrix4 | inline |
setTrans(const Vector3 &v) | ParaEngine::Matrix4 | inline |
transformAffine(const Vector3 &v) const | ParaEngine::Matrix4 | inline |
transformAffine(const Vector4 &v) const | ParaEngine::Matrix4 | inline |
transpose(void) const (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| inline |
ZERO (defined in ParaEngine::Matrix4) | ParaEngine::Matrix4 | static |